Comprehending Cooling Agent Issues
Refrigerant concerns can greatly impact the effectiveness of a cooling and heating system. Homeowners need to understand the signs of low cooling agent levels and the value of detecting refrigerant leaks. Addressing these problems without delay can prevent more damages to the system and warranty peak cooling down performance.
Reduced Cooling Agent Degrees
A typical problem that house owners may encounter with their HVAC systems is low cooling agent levels, which can significantly affect the system's efficiency and efficiency. Cooling agent is crucial for the cooling process, absorbing warm from indoor air and releasing it outside. When levels go down, the cooling system has a hard time to cool the room effectively, causing enhanced power intake and prospective system strain. Symptoms of reduced cooling agent include insufficient air conditioning, longer run times, and ice formation on the evaporator coils. Home owners may also see unusual noises as the compressor functions harder to make up for the deficiency. It is essential for property owners to comprehend the relevance of maintaining appropriate cooling agent degrees to guarantee peak HVAC performance and durability.
Refrigerant Leaks Detection
Where might a homeowner start when confronted with the opportunity of refrigerant leakages in their a/c system? The first action entails keeping track of the system's efficiency. Signs such as lowered cooling down efficiency, ice development on coils, or hissing sounds might indicate a cooling agent leakage. Homeowners ought to also look for visible indications of oil deposit, commonly an indication of a leak. Making use of a cooling agent leak detector can offer more accurate recognition. If suspicions continue, getting in touch with a certified cooling and heating professional is vital, as they have the expertise and devices to locate leakages successfully. Motivate discovery and repair of refrigerant leaks not just enhance system effectiveness but also prevent prospective environmental harm, making it an essential facet of heating and cooling maintenance.

Clogged Filters and Their Consequences
While several home owners might neglect the value of routine filter maintenance, blocked filters can result in considerable repercussions for HVAC systems. When filters become blocked with dust, dust, and particles, air movement is restricted. This reduction in airflow forces the system to function harder, bring about boosted power usage and possibly greater utility expenses. Over time, this stress can create damage on elements, resulting in early system failing.
Additionally, clogged up filters can compromise indoor air top quality. Contaminants and allergens may distribute throughout the home, aggravating respiratory concerns and allergic reactions for occupants. Furthermore, inadequate air flow can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, causing expensive repair services and inefficient cooling performance. Frequently transforming or cleaning up filters is a simple yet essential upkeep task that can aid ensure the long life and efficiency of heating and cooling systems, eventually profiting both the home owner's comfort and their finances.
